      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hi,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I'm facing 2 type of issues in RWB,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Issue 1) Adapter Engine is in Red State in Component monitoring,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Error: Details for 'Is the Adapter Engine Running?'&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Response from Adapter Engine: Fatal ArchiveJob (Archiving) failed.(Details: Code: MS.JOB.ARCHIVE; Location: com.sap.engine.messaging.impl.core.job.executor.ArchiveExecutor; Reason: java.io.IOException: The HTTP request of command "MODIFYPATH" did not reach the XMLDAS. This may indicate that the credentials for the HTTP destination have expired.; Time: 31.03.2011 00:00:05)Response from Adapter Engine: Fatal ArchiveJob (Archiving) failed.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;2) If I click, any one of the option like Communication Channel monitoring, Engine Status etc, I'm getting the error &l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;"Internet Explorer cannot display the webpage"&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;It seems to be the URL to open these component(Communication Channel monitoring, Engine Status etc ) is wrong. Fromwhere the URL address is taken? Where we need check the host name??&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I searched in sdn, but could not find any related topics. &l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Kindly help me resolve this issue ASAP.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thanks &amp;amp; Regards,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Baskaran K&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hi Baskaran,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;For 1), did you check if the XML DAS communication user (used in destination "DASdefault") is configured correctly according to the documentation &lt;A href="http://help.sap.com/saphelp_nwpi71/helpdata/EN/43/68fac39a363d33e10000000a11466f/frameset.htm" target="test_blank"&gt;http://help.sap.com/saphelp_nwpi71/helpdata/EN/43/68fac39a363d33e10000000a11466f/frameset.htm&lt;/A&gt; and is assigned to the "XMLDASSecurityRole" role?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;And check if you have configured the rules for your Archiving job (Component Monitoring -&amp;gt; Adapter Engine XIE -&amp;gt; Background Processing).&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;It seems the archiving does not work because of configuration issues.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;An archiving job without rules means: all messages are relevant for archiving. The delete job will only delete messages which are not relevant for archiving. So it does not do anything in this system. It can lead to the database table keeps growing, if it's the case too.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;You should check the archiving configuration so that the archiving job runs successfully.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If you do not want to archive the messages, please deactivate the archiving job. Then the delete job should clean the old messages with the next execution.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;You may delete it straightly on the Background Processing.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;For the 2), "Internet Explorer cannot display the webpage", try using the compatibility mode of your browser.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Regards,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Caio Cagnani&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
